Propagation of ultrahigh-energy neutrinos through the Earth
Abstract
The dispersion relation in matter of ultrahigh-energy neutrinos above the pole of the $W$ resonance ($E_ν \gsim {\rm 10}^{7} {\rm GeV} $), is studied. We perform our calculation using the real-time formulation of Thermal Field Theory in which the massless limit for the $W$ boson is taken. The range of active-to-sterile neutrino oscillation parameters for which there is significant mixing enhancement during propagation through the interior of the Earth, and therefore significant attenuation of neutrino beams in the Earth at high energies, is estimated. Finally, this range is considered in view of the cosmological and astrophysical constraints.
